Early Life and Career Beginnings

Antonio Banderas was born on August 10, 1960, in Málaga, Spain. Growing up in a modest family, he developed a passion for the arts at an early age. He studied at the School of Dramatic Art in Málaga and soon began to make a name for himself in Spanish theater. His breakout role came in the late 1980s when he collaborated with acclaimed director Pedro Almodóvar. This partnership was pivotal, as it introduced Banderas to international audiences and showcased his talent in films such as "Women on the Verge of a Nervous Breakdown" and "The Law of Desire."

Rise to Hollywood Stardom

Banderas made his Hollywood debut in the 1992 film "The Mambo Kings," but it was his role in "Desperado" alongside Salma Hayek that solidified his status as a leading man. His charisma and unique blend of charm and intensity captivated audiences and critics alike. Banderas went on to star in a series of successful films, including "The Mask of Zorro" and "Spy Kids," which showcased his versatility as an actor and broadened his appeal across different genres.

Not Just an Actor

While Banderas is primarily known for his acting, he has also ventured into directing and producing. His directorial debut, "Crazy in Alabama," was released in 1999 and featured his then-wife, Melanie Griffith. Banderas has continued to explore behind-the-scenes roles, contributing to various projects that reflect his artistic vision. His passion for storytelling extends beyond the screen, as he has expressed interest in theater and other artistic endeavors.
